Output 5c57538f3daef46e3c43a5d2dda7be5b340e418a15a171d63e74391a8ca21d4e:1

value
8367184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868a261065a994c6073750d94d337b3791b3fd4b OP_EQUAL
address
3DxPxzGKQzviv2fEv7KkZ51wS1xaSbFCxC
transaction
5c57538f3daef46e3c43a5d2dda7be5b340e418a15a171d63e74391a8ca21d4e
confirmations
190271
spent
true